omole-ibukun

3 Articles by:

Omole Ibukun

Omole Ibukun is a socialist activist based in Abuja, Nigeria.

Website

Talking down on speaking up

Beyond the social media firestorm over journalist Trish Lorenz’s book about #EndSARS, it is worth engaging in the debate about wider representation in movement building and protest.